Output e3dbcc5c0f64fa8e8a2d1ed4bcc6d6423aa93f247cde973ff80c47fcf91c580d:1

value
82113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e324c49f58e60c0538f6a4f5088501027c8e53d OP_EQUAL
address
3BjgWQq3zWndAYAczjtqTFTBxpejBoDxQU
transaction
e3dbcc5c0f64fa8e8a2d1ed4bcc6d6423aa93f247cde973ff80c47fcf91c580d
confirmations
12593
spent
true